Automated Plate Handlers Market Size
Automated Plate Handlers Market Analysis
The Automated Plate Handlers Market size is estimated at USD 4.26 billion in 2025, and is expected to reach USD 5.60 billion by 2030, at a CAGR of 5.36% during the forecast period (2025-2030).
- Life science applications, from drug discovery to systems biology, are increasingly embracing automation. The diagnostics market, particularly clinical diagnostics, heavily relies on automation. Here, profit margins hinge on the volume of samples processed, making high throughput a key driver. Automation ensures faster and more accurate processing of samples, which is critical in meeting the growing demand for diagnostic services.
- Automated plate handlers are witnessing a surge, primarily due to a marked increase in sample throughput and a notable reduction in the time taken to yield experimental results. By minimizing human errors, like pipetting inaccuracies or mislabeling, that can jeopardize experimental outcomes and data integrity, automation plays a pivotal role. Furthermore, these handlers accelerate laboratory workflows, enabling researchers to expedite experiments. This boost in efficiency not only curtails labor hours but also amplifies overall productivity, leading to significant cost savings.
- Microplate automation instruments are becoming indispensable in laboratories, enhancing throughput and scalability across diverse protocols. These include high-throughput screening, next-generation sequencing, cellular analysis, PCR setup, serial dilution, toxicology assessments, and plate labeling. Beyond streamlining routine tasks, the demand for automated plate handlers is also fueled by the imperative for consistent quality, given the high stakes of errors in laboratory settings.
- Laboratory plate handling systems find applications across multiple industries. In pharmaceutical research, they accelerate drug screening and toxicity assessments, enabling faster identification of potential drug candidates. The biotechnology realm benefits from genomics and proteomics research, where managing numerous samples is crucial for understanding complex biological systems. Moreover, in clinical diagnostics, these systems enhance high-throughput testing, proving vital in molecular diagnostics and personalized medicine. Their ability to process large volumes of samples efficiently supports advancements in diagnostic accuracy and patient-specific treatment approaches.
- Yet, the journey isn't without hurdles. The substantial initial investment and the necessity for specialized maintenance pose challenges, curbing broader adoption. Smaller laboratories, in particular, may find it difficult to justify the upfront costs, despite the long-term benefits. Additionally, the need for skilled personnel to operate and maintain these systems adds to the operational complexity.

Drug Discovery Segment to Witness High Growth
- Typically, it takes years for a medical compound to transition from a conceptual target to a revenue-generating medication. This journey involves multiple phases in drug discovery and development (DDD), including target identification, validation, lead compound identification, preclinical testing, and clinical trials. Each phase requires significant time, resources, and expertise.
- Rising costs of pharmaceutical products have prompted industry players to modernize traditional processes. The manual procedures in drug discovery are not only time-consuming but also complex and costly. These challenges have driven many drug discovery units to adopt automation and robotics in their research laboratories, aiming to enhance efficiency and reduce costs.
- In the DDD process for new therapies, automated plate handlers play a crucial role in streamlining laboratory workflows. These systems enable high-throughput screening, precise sample handling, and data accuracy, significantly reducing the time required for drug discovery. Tasks that once took months to complete manually can now be finished in just a day with modular automation systems, improving overall productivity and accelerating the development timeline.

Automated Plate Handlers Market News
- January 2025: INTEGRA Biosciences enhanced its WELLJET dispenser stacker, now enabling the automated processing of deep well plates up to 45 mm tall. This upgrade tackles significant challenges in high-throughput workflows, empowering laboratories to manage larger sample volumes efficiently in both 96 and 384-well formats.
- March 2024: Azenta Life Sciences introduced its latest innovation, the Automated Plate Seal Remover. Tailored for laboratories that frequently remove microplate seals, this device prioritizes the preservation of sample integrity. As an automated solution, it secures the plate while deftly peeling away the seal, thereby mitigating the cross-contamination risks often associated with manual seal removal methods.
Automated Plate Handlers Industry Segmentation
Designed for seamless integration with various laboratory devices, an automated plate handler serves as a sophisticated storage and handling system. Featuring a high-speed robot and a modular design, this plate handler offers the flexibility and scalability to cater to a wide range of laboratory applications.
